What Are Dog Microchips & Why Are They Essential?

The Core Purpose of Dog Microchips

Dog microchips are small RFID implants designed to store a unique, unalterable identification number linked to a dog’s owner and medical records. The devices provide a permanent, tamper-proof form of identification that cannot be lost, removed, or damaged like collars and tags.

Real-World Benefits

Microchips drastically increase the rate of lost dog recovery by providing a verifiable link between a found dog and its owner. They also support official pet registration, simplify veterinary record management, and meet regulatory requirements for domestic and international pet travel.

Technical Specifications of Dog Microchips

Frequency & Protocol Compatibility

All dog microchips operate at a standard 134.2 kHz frequency, with support for FDX-B, FDX-A, and HDX protocols to ensure compatibility with nearly all public and private pet scanners worldwide.

Chip Models & Biocompatible Materials

Available chip models include EM4305, EM4100, ID, and UHF variants to suit different use cases. All chips are encased in medical grade bioglass, a non-reactive material that minimizes risk of tissue irritation or rejection after implantation.

Size Options for Different Dog Breeds & Ages

Size variants are customized by protocol: FDX-A models range from 1.4x8mm to 4x34mm, FDX-B models range from 1.25x7mm to 4x34mm, and HDX models range from 2x12mm to 4x34mm. Smaller sizes are recommended for puppies and toy breeds, while larger sizes are suited for adult large breed dogs.

Protocol Size Range Compatible Chip Models
FDX-A 1.4x8mm to 4x34mm EM4100, ID
FDX-B 1.25x7mm to 4x34mm EM4305, EM4100, ID, UHF
HDX 2x12mm to 4x34mm EM4305, UHF

Implantation & Post-Care Guide for Dog Microchips

Syringe Implantation Process

Microchips are pre-loaded in sterile, single-use syringes for administration by licensed veterinarians. The implantation process takes less than 10 seconds, involves injection between the shoulder blades under the skin, and causes minimal discomfort comparable to a standard vaccination.

Safe Post-Implantation Care Tips

After implantation, avoid touching the injection site for 24 hours, and restrict strenuous activity for 3 to 5 days to allow the chip to settle in place. Monitor the site for redness or swelling, and contact a veterinarian if any adverse reactions persist for more than 48 hours.

How to Scan & Access Your Dog’s ID Number

To retrieve the unique identification number, a compatible scanner is waved over the implantation site to pick up the 134.2 kHz signal from the chip. The ID number can then be cross-referenced with national or international pet registration databases to access owner contact and medical record information.

Certifications & Global Compliance Standards

ICAR Certification: What It Means for Your Pet

ICAR certification ensures the microchip meets global standards for unique identification number allocation, data integrity, and scanner compatibility. ICAR-certified chips are recognized by all major pet registration bodies worldwide.

ISO 11784/11785: Ensuring International Compatibility

Compliance with ISO 11784 and 11785 standards guarantees the microchip is compatible with scanners used in nearly all countries, making it suitable for international pet travel. These standards are a mandatory requirement for entry into most countries with pet import regulations.

Frequently Asked Questions About Dog Microchips

Are dog microchips safe? Yes, all chips are encased in medical grade bioglass and have been tested for long-term safety, with extremely low rates of adverse reactions reported.

Can microchips migrate from the implantation site? Microchip migration is rare, occurring in less than 1% of cases, and does not impact the functionality of the device or the ability to scan it.

Do microchips store medical information? Microchips store a unique identification number that links to external databases where owner contact and medical information can be stored and updated as needed.

How long do dog microchips last? All microchips have an operational lifespan of 10 or more years, with no battery required for operation.

Do microchips work with all scanners? 134.2 kHz microchips supporting FDX-B, FDX-A, and HDX protocols are compatible with over 99% of pet scanners in use globally.
